How do you trade online for beginners?

The first step will be to find an online stockbroker. They provide you with the facility to open a demat and trading account. A trading account helps you place a buy or sell order in the stock market, whereas a demat account stores the shares you buy in a digital format.

How much money do I need to invest in stocks to make $3000 a month?

According to FIRE, your portfolio should cover 25 times your annual expenses. Then, if you withdraw 4% of your portfolio every year, your portfolio will continue to grow and won't be compromised. We can apply this formula to the goal of making $3,000 a month like this: $3,000 x 12 months x 25 years = $900,000.

Why do most traders lose money?

One of the primary reasons why traders lose money is because they fail to manage their risk effectively. It's crucial to set stop-loss orders and appropriately size positions to control your losses when trading stocks. Without proper risk management, even a single bad trade can wipe out a good chunk of your profits.

How much money do you need to start day trading?

The amount of money you need to begin day trading depends on the type of securities you want to buy. Stocks typically trade in round lots, or orders of at least 100 shares. 1 To buy a stock priced at $60 per share, you will need $6,000 in your account.

How much money do I need to invest to make $1000 a month?

The truth is that most investors won't have the money to generate $1,000 per month in dividends; not at first, anyway. Even if you find a market-beating series of investments that average 3% annual yield, you would still need $400,000 in up-front capital to hit your targets. And that's okay.

What if I invest $500 a month for 30 years?

If you simply match the historic stock market returns over the past 90 years -- returns that averaged 10% per year -- investing $500 per month will net you over $1 million in 30 years.
